Job Description Summary

Reporting to the Associate Director, Enterprise Applications Solutions, the Enterprise Integration and Application Developer will be responsible for developing and supporting over 60 application integrations in a complex environment including both SaaS and cloud-based systems such as Workday, Slate, and Brightspace. The role will also contribute to mission critical efforts to develop a modern integrations environment.

The ideal candidate will have excellent analytical skills and extensive experience developing integrations between applications and within a data lake environment. The Enterprise Integration and Application Developer will have solid, hands-on experience with SQL, XSL, PL/SQL, web services, JSON, API development, and tools that are used to extract, transform, and manage data. The ideal candidate will have strong communications skills and the ability to work collaboratively with technical and non-technical staff in multiple business areas.

Essential Duties

This role is responsible for hands on sourcing, manipulation, and delivery of data between enterprise business systems in collaboration with a small integrations team. This role will troubleshoot and support enterprise applications and their data integrations and feeds to ensure that committed service levels are being met and corrective actions are implemented when they are not. This role will work closely with business analysts, the data warehouse team, and staff in multiple departments across the university.

Key duties include:

  • Participating in ongoing data modernization and integration re-platforming program at Bentley to simplify, streamline and modernize the current integrations environment.
  • Supporting the day-to-day operation of cloud-based applications and developing minor/moderate customizations or scripts to address business needs.
  • Sourcing data from enterprise business systems and designing and deploying processes to extract and load data between source and target systems.
  • Engaging and collaborating early on new projects to understand application and integration requirements and to map them into the existing integration and application architecture at Bentley.
  • Day-to-day monitoring and support of applications and existing integration jobs and other scheduled data jobs to alert, identify, and mitigate data quality and data integrity issues.
  • Design and implementation of data movement monitoring processes and alerts.
  • Troubleshooting of application and data issues reported by business departments and collaboration with users to identify and mitigate root causes.
  • Collaborating with other IT teams and data security teams in securing and managing Bentley data.
  • Working closely with data governance team members to develop catalogs, dictionaries, and other tools to manage data definitions at Bentley.

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ree.
  • 3-5 years related experience.
  • Proven experience with integration methodologies such as SQL, Python, XSL, Web Services, APIs, and GraphQL.
  • Solid command of current integrations best practices and governance models.
  • Proven ability to troubleshoot application issues, existing integrations, data flows, and data transformations.
  • Strong interpersonal and teamwork skills with both IT colleagues, business analysts, analytics staff, and business users across the organization.
  • Ability to understand and synthesize data and transformation requirements working with business users.
  • Ability to write, troubleshoot, and resolve issues with SQL.
  • Experience with cloud-based systems - SaaS, PaaS, and understanding of industry-standard enterprise application support and data management practices.
  • Knowledge of custom application development design patterns.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Knowledge of modern, iPaaS tools such as Snaplogic.
  • Knowledge of Microsoft data management tools (Azure Data Factory, Logic Apps, Power BI).
  • Higher education experience preferred, but not required.
  • Workday experience preferred, but not required.
